我在slx分支上,如何把master的分支拉取到slx分支上
结论:git pull origin master
详细解释
要将 master 分支的最新更改合并到 slx 分支上,你可以按照以下步骤进行操作:
使用命令行进行合并
-  确保在 slx分支上在开始之前,确保你当前在 slx分支上。你可以通过以下命令确认当前所在分支:git branch如果不在 slx分支上,请先切换到slx分支:git checkout slx
-  拉取 master分支的最新更改在 slx分支上,使用git pull命令拉取master分支的最新更改:git pull origin master- git pull:从远程仓库拉取最新的提交。
- origin master:表示从远程仓库 (- origin) 的- master分支拉取最新的提交。
 
-  解决冲突(如果有) 如果 master分支的更改与slx分支上的更改产生冲突,你需要解决这些冲突。Git 会在合并过程中显示冲突的文件,并帮助你手动解决冲突。- 打开有冲突的文件,手动解决冲突(通常在文件中有 <<<<<<<,=======,>>>>>>>的标记来标示冲突段落)。
- 解决冲突后,使用 git add命令将修改后的文件标记为已解决。
- 最后使用 git commit提交合并结果。
 
- 打开有冲突的文件,手动解决冲突(通常在文件中有 
-  提交合并结果 如果有冲突,解决完冲突后,使用以下命令提交合并结果: git commit -m "Merge changes from master into slx branch"
-  推送到远程仓库 将合并后的 slx分支推送到远程仓库:git push origin slx
使用图形化工具进行合并
如果你更喜欢使用图形化工具来处理分支合并,可以使用 Git 图形化界面工具(如 GitKraken、Sourcetree 等)。这些工具通常提供了直观的界面来进行分支合并和解决冲突。
注意事项
- 在进行分支合并前,确保你理解 master分支和slx分支的关系,并确认合并操作不会影响到其他人的工作。
- 合并分支可能会导致冲突,特别是当 master分支和slx分支同时修改了相同的文件或代码块时。解决冲突是合并过程中常见的任务之一。
- 在合并前,建议先进行测试和代码审查,确保合并后的代码的质量和稳定性。
通过以上步骤,你可以将 master 分支的最新更改成功合并到 slx 分支上,并将修改推送到远程仓库。